How I work

A senior designer who decides what to build with data.

I'm an analytical thinker: I work through a problem space with product data to judge which design changes will actually move the user experience and the business metrics, and which are not worth the team's time. I test prototypes with users myself, and I design inside a design system — extending it when a new pattern is genuinely needed.

01 — Discovery

I prioritise with data, not opinion.

I work through problem spaces analytically, using Mixpanel and Looker to find where the team can make the most meaningful impact — on user value, conversion, and business metrics. Once a quarter we step back for a design sprint to reframe those opportunities.

02 — Research

I test from a hypothesis — and I run the tests myself.

I run smaller-scale tests myself, which has made me sharper about when a quick test is enough and when we need something rigorous. Either way I start from a clear hypothesis: what do I expect to happen, and what would change my mind? Beyond testing, we release to a subset of users and let behaviour tell us what works.

03 — Craft

I design both sides of a marketplace, app and web.

A mobile app for workers, a web platform for companies. Where possible I push for mobile-adaptive solutions on the B2B side too, so the most critical actions are never tied to a desk. I work within a design system and extend it when a new pattern is genuinely needed — the micro-decisions that make a journey feel consistent and accessible, not pixel perfection for its own sake.
